Grasping the UK Visa Requirements

Navigating the nuances of UK visa requirements can be a difficult task. To guarantee a smooth and successful application, it is crucial to carefully understand the particular rules and regulations that relate to your individual case.

Firstly, determine the correct visa category according to the purpose of your journey to the UK. Whether you are planning a temporary stay for leisure, studying at a UK university, or seeking work, there is a relevant visa category that fulfills your needs.

Once you have determined the right visa category, thoroughly review the criteria. This may involve submitting documents such as a valid copyright, proof of financial means, and a thorough travel itinerary.

Ultimately, it is always recommended to consult the UK government's official website or contact their visa processing center for the most up-to-date information and guidance on UK visa requirements.

Travelling to Britain: Immigration Rules for Visitors

Britain's immigration rules for visitors are designed ensure a safe and welcoming experience for your stay. Based on your nationality, you may need the copyright enter the country. It's crucial to check the specific requirements for your citizenship before you travel. Upon arrival, visitors are generally allowed remain in Britain for a period of six months. However, this can change depending on the purpose of your visit.

Your will need a valid copyright and proof that sufficient funds support your stay. Furthermore, you may be required to provide proof of accommodation or onward travel arrangements. It's always best recommended check the UK government website about the most up-to-date information on immigration rules as well as visa requirements.
